Trainer John OâShea will give serious consideration to a 2016 Queen Elizabeth Stakes bid next month with Itâs Somewhat after the import won the Ajax Stakes on Coolmore Classic Day.

In the third win for Godolphin at Rosehill Gardens at the meeting, Dynaformer gelding Itâs Somewhat enjoyed a notable weight relief from his lead-up runs carrying 57.5kg home in the $157,000 Group 2 Ajax Stakes (1500m).
Jumping from a wide barrier in the handicap clash, the five-year-old had Sam Clipperton in the saddle fresh off his maiden Group 1 winning ride aboard the Ron Quinton-trained Peeping in the Coolmore Classic.
OâShea admitted post-win that perhaps they should have put the stableâs number one hoop James McDonald aboard, but Clipperton did a great job getting Itâs Somewhat home first past the post in the Group 2.
âWeâd made the bookingsâ¦I thought Iâd made a blue, but good on Sammy,â OâShea said.
âHeâs a young jockey with his tail in the air and he rode well today.â
Last time out the horse ran a first-up sixth to Charlie Boy in the Group 3 Liverpool City Cup (1300m), a race he won last Sydney Autumn Racing Carnival before a failed ninth to Real Impact in the Group 1 George Ryder Stakes (1500m).
That followed strong summer placings when runner-up in the Listed Festival Stakes (1500m) carrying 59kg and third to Happy Clapper in the Group 2 Villiers Stakes (1600m) with the same weight in December.
âHeâs been racing very well during the summer with massive weights and he was just looking for a bit of weight relief and he got it today,â OâShea explained.
Second-up the Ajax Stakes suited Itâs Somewhat to a tee this season, Clipperton taking the horse up close to the speed to settle second behind Chris Wallerâs Group 1 Railway Stakes winner in Perth Good Project.
Good Project hopped out in front to lead from the eventual winner while Casino Dancer tracked in third ahead of Wallerâs Kool Kompany.
Around the turn Itâs Somewhat ($8) was travelling very strongly and shaded Good Project to snare front running 300m from the line.
He drew clear over the closing stages, holding off the challenges after enjoying a ride on pace to beat home the returning Gai Waterhouse-trained Lexus Stakes winner from the spring Excess Knowledge ($11) having his first run since a seventh in the Group 1 Melbourne Cup (3200m) over the two miles last November.
Finishing off the Ajax Stakes trifecta in third, missing out on second in a photo for the placings with Excess Knowledge, was Gerald Ryanâs roughie hope Dances On Stars ($34) who made up all the late ground coming from last to finish in the money.
Good tactics got the good win on the day, Itâs Somewhat still looking to have plenty of upside ahead of tougher races coming up at Royal Randwick during Aprilâs âThe Championshipsâ.
OâShea is hoping to extend the horse out over 2000m for the first time in Australia to tackle Wallerâs mighty mare Winx on April 9 in the $4 million Group 1 Queen Elizabeth Stakes (2000m).
He is also nominated for the shorter-distanced $3 million Group 1 Doncaster Mile (1600m) as a âPlan Bâ.
âIâve been really keen to get him out to the 10 furlongs (2000m) and lead on him,â OâShea said.
âHeâs in the big one (the Queen Elizabeth Stakes), but weâre yet to get him to 10 furlongs in Australia.
âHeâs in the Doncaster too so heâs got a few options.â
OâShea said the horseâs third in the 2014 Group 1 Eclipse Stakes (2000m) in Britain could prove good enough form to win the Queen Elizabeth Stakes this autumn.
âHe has run third in an Eclipse Stakes, thatâ probably better form for the Queen Elizabeth,â he said.
âIt will be interesting to see when we get him over that.â
